About Pestana Alvor South Beach
Here the South Beach is purely metaphorical — the Pestana Alvor South Beach takes its name and style inspiration from Miami’s most popular neighborhood. Design-wise, it’s a bit of a departure from the traditional resorts and hotels that line this stretch of Portugal’s southern coast. Then again, the geography and climate — wide, sandy beaches, crashing waves, endless sunshine — is similar enough to Florida. Why shouldn’t an Art Deco hotel work? Why not, indeed, mount the ceilings with colorful artwork and line the walls with fanciful wallpaper? Why not forgo one gigantic swimming pool for a trio of infinity pools and rows of cheerful yellow chaise lounges arranged on a wooden deck? Why not skip the Portuguese breakfast buffet and opt for a detox smoothie; why not trade off those generic strawberry daiquiris for spicy wasabi cocktails delivered with a flourish by poolside attendants called the Pool Girl and the Ice Cream Boy? The Pestana Alvor South Beach has originality, surely, and a kitschy sense of humor that sets it apart from the neighbors. But there’s substance here. Guest rooms and suites, done up in bright whites and nautical stripes, are spacious and quiet. Some have balconies and sea views; all have flat-screen TVs and free wi-fi. A contemporary continental breakfast is served in the light-filled restaurant — the kitchen is open all day, except for dinner. Luckily, you’re just a few minutes’ walk from the cafés, bars, and restaurants of Alvor Beach. Go ahead, take the scenic route along the sand: the sea, as the Pestana Alvor South Beach frequently reminds its guests, is just 97 steps away.
